]> git.ipfire.org Git - thirdparty/git.git/commitdiff
sequencer: remove pointless rollback_lock_file()
authorOswald Buddenhagen <oswald.buddenhagen@gmx.de>
Thu, 23 Mar 2023 16:22:35 +0000 (17:22 +0100)
committerJunio C Hamano <gitster@pobox.com>
Fri, 24 Mar 2023 14:52:16 +0000 (07:52 -0700)
The file is gone even if commit_lock_file() fails.

Signed-off-by: Oswald Buddenhagen <oswald.buddenhagen@gmx.de>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
sequencer.c

index c9655edffa5b227f7228956d351e89be4f9d2612..1d5ff86eadbdd9e9400f507746d722d257a55e12 100644 (file)
@@ -2530,7 +2530,6 @@ static int safe_append(const char *filename, const char *fmt, ...)
        }
        if (commit_lock_file(&lock) < 0) {
                strbuf_release(&buf);
-               rollback_lock_file(&lock);
                return error(_("failed to finalize '%s'"), filename);
        }